NEW YORK -- The various categories of absorbency products have proved to be fertile ground for private label development. As highly consumable commodity items, their price points are attractive to value-seeking shoppers, while their high turns and high gross margins make them appealing to retailers.

For instance, according to Nielsen Co., private label items in the adult incontinence category claimed 31.5% of 2007 sales of $917.2 million through food, drug and discount outlets (including Nielsen household panel data to capture sales of Wal-Mart Stores Inc.).
